Output 66ea05e4fa693208d2b3c515d4bf4a6ce2ceb3dd3db43dc7d600163425b00650:1

value
6953544183116
script pubkey
OP_0 OP_PUSHBYTES_20 e194a261f6def6ee8ce4479cea43fb57e6746010
address
tb1qux22yc0kmmmwar8yg7ww5slm2ln8gcqsdpxsdf
transaction
66ea05e4fa693208d2b3c515d4bf4a6ce2ceb3dd3db43dc7d600163425b00650
confirmations
113579
spent
true